    O mapa são os outros: narrativas da viagem de migrantes centro-americanos na fronteira sul do México

    Get PDF
    This article analyses the ways in which Central American migrants travelling through Mexico to reach the United States make oral maps to orient themselves during their journeys. These migrants, often fleeing poverty and violence, travel through Mexico in very irregular ways, such as on cargo trains or on-foot, and find themselves in a state of high vulnerability. Many of these travelers do not have access to printed or digital maps and as a result must rely on oral maps that the migrants create through their multiple attempts to cross the northern border into the United States. These oral maps narrate their journeys and in particular help to navigate specific parts of their journeys to the northern border.     Almacenamiento energético frente al inminente paradigma renovable: el rol de las baterías ion-litio y las perspectivas sudamericanas/Energy storage towards the imminent renewable paradigm: the role of ion-lithium batteries and South American perspectives

    Get PDF
    The current global energy system is characterized by a high dependence on fossil fuels, a paradigm that begins to encounter difficulties as existing reserves are depleted and ecological costs increase. Thus, the incorporation of renewable energies, their generation in a distributed form and the growth of the electric motor park, are presented as the most promising triad in the conformation of a new, more efficient and sustainable paradigm. This article focuses on the importance that energy accumulators acquire in this scenario, mainly due to their role in stabilizing networks and enabling self-consumption and electric propulsion.     Continuidad y renovación en la acción colectiva de los ganaderos familiares del litoral noroeste de Uruguay

    Get PDF
    Uruguayan cattle raising has provided the image of independent cattle farmers, isolated in scattered exploitations, without organizations or groups. However, reality shows that it is common for family cattle farmers to be integrated into one or several forms of groups of diverse nature. The transformations that have occurred in recent years have challenged left Governments to find the right tools to apply policies and differential support to family cattle farmers, which allows them to improve their competitiveness and sustainability. One of the strategies is the promotion of associative processes as a transversal axis. This study identifies and classifies existing forms of collectives in the northwest coast of the country, analyzing the processes through which individuals are involved in collective action. The identification of four types of collective action is the result of the review of secondary sources and the interviews conducted.     Securitización como supervivencia, securitización como actos del habla: crítica a la Escuela de Copenhague / Securitization as Survival, Securitization as a Speech Act: A Critic to the Copenhagen School

    Get PDF
    The present paper addresses how the theoretical framework of the securitisation theory, conceived by the Copenhagen School, embraces unique features of the traditional security studies. Its central focus is the assessment of the conceptions of security as survival embedded in the logic of the speech act theory, and the characterisation of the role endows to the securitising agents and the audience.
